Output 7006da238765b659d95b3e2f7e8d038a44d6e1f8c1eeac6de3703f91f43820b4:0

value
2348970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e050dc278b66735c09a517f3072da9314a3678 OP_EQUAL
address
3CXaNvFNoALdpe468kEhACYn7GEyzsTV6s
transaction
7006da238765b659d95b3e2f7e8d038a44d6e1f8c1eeac6de3703f91f43820b4
confirmations
477140
spent
true